The Rode VideoMic Me Directional Mic is a compact and lightweight microphone designed for use with smartphones. It features an in-built 3.5mm TRRS output for direct connection to a smartphone's headphone socket. The VideoMic Me is ideal for shooting mobile videos, offering better audio quality than your phone's built-in microphone. It’s also perfect for recording voiceovers or ADR on the go. The flexible mounting bracket accommodates a wide range of smartphones, allowing it to be used for both primary camera and front camera ('selfie') shots. A 3.5mm headphone jack on the rear enables audio play-through while recording (app-dependent) and makes it easy to play back videos without removing the microphone. The VideoMic Me is equipped with a Pressure Gradient Electret Condenser Acoustic Principle, JFET impedance converter, and a 0.50" capsule. It has an address type of End, a frequency range of 100Hz-20kHz, a maximum SPL of 140dBSPL, a sensitivity of -33.0dB re 1 Volt/Pascal (22.00mV @ 94 dB SPL) +/- 2 dB @ 1kHz, and an equivalent noise level (A-weighted) of 20dBA. It also includes a deluxe furry windshield for shooting outdoors or in adverse weather conditions.
